winter tires

  1. Central Canada Owners
    Hi There, wondering if anyone can recommend a specific mechanic they trust to work on their Element in the GTA. Or do you go to a Honda Dealer for repairs etc....and if so, what is your favourite Honda Dealer to take your Element in to? (a side note, I've also got to track down 225/55r18...